Chicken Robots

Japanese toy maker Sega is selling cyborg chicks that look and feel like the real thing. The palm-sized robots, named Yume Hiyoko, or 'dream chicks,' join a line of mechanical pets that includes dogs, cats and ponies.

The chick has touch sensors that trigger it to chirp or flap its wings when its back is stroked. The robot chicks were modeled after newly hatched birds and cost about $19.
